Episode Synopsis

Nina Kimball of Kimball Brousseau LLP and Jaclyn Kugell of Morgan, Brown & Joy LLP discuss leave entitlements and protections for employees who are unwilling or unable to work due to COVID-19 in this podcast excerpted from MCLE’s 8/10/2020 program, Emerging COVID-19 Employment Law Issues - Privacy, Travel Restrictions & Other Thorny Developments: The 60-Minute Lawyer.
